When a Quillport export job fails three times, the worker suspends the owning service account. To retry, first clear the job from the dead-letter queue, then reinstate the account via the admin CLI. Reinstatement requires unlocking the export keyring, which is sealed after any suspension. Do not regenerate the keyring; that invalidates in-flight exports for every tenant. Future maintainers: the unlock prompt accepts only the recovery passphrase recorded below, so keep this page current whenever it rotates.

vault phrase of yageg-kaduf = drumir-eliok-julael-fraath-norael-fraox-silax

Ticket FX-2281: Rounding errors in currency conversion. The Moneta service accumulates sub-cent discrepancies when converting batches between minor-unit currencies; totals drift by up to 0.04 per thousand transactions. Proposed fix switches to banker's rounding applied once at batch settlement rather than per line item. Regression suite passes; reconciliation reports now balance in staging. Needs review at this week's sync before merge to the release branch. Sign-off is required from the engineer named below.

signatory, kaweg-fawig: Zorys Druys Jorius Novael

Ticket: Staging env misconfigured for Siftgate bloom filter

The bloom layer in front of the Pellet KV store is rejecting all lookups in staging because the env file was copied from the dev template without credentials. False-positive tuning values are fine; only the auth line is missing. To unblock the weekly demo, the Pellet admission secret must be set on the following line.

env line for yaguf-fajop: LEDGER_TOKEN13=fb08984397349